Mennonite Weekly Review obituary: 1955 Aug 25 p. 8

Birth date: 1894 Jan 29

text of obituary:

BERNHARD PENNER

Bernhard Penner was born Jan. 29, 1894, the son of Andreas and helen (nee Reiemer) Penner, at Beatrice, Neb.

He received his education in the local public school and the Mennonite Parochial school.

In 1912 he was baptized upon the confession of his faith by Elder Gerhard Penner.

He was united in marriage with Helen Zimmerman on Feb. 7, 1929. They made their home on a farm northwest of Beatrice where he lived until his death. Two sons were born into this home, Bernherd [sic Bernhard] Jr. and Gerald.

He experienced ill health in 1934 and since then had experienced periods of good health and poorer health. In recent weeks he had been confined to the Mennonite Hospital.

He answered the call of his Heavenly Father on July 31, 1955.

He is survived by his wife, Helen, two sons, Bernhard jr. and Gerald, one sister, Marie, and many other relatives and friends.
